For example, a common phrase you’ll learn quickly here is:

  • “Che!” (chee) – “Hey!” or “Dude!” This is an omnipresent Argentine interjection. You’ll hear it constantly in informal conversations. ¡Che, qué bueno que estás leyendo esto! (Hey, how good that you’re reading this!)
  • “¿Todo bien?” (TO-do byen) – “Everything good?” / “How are you?” A very common greeting among friends.

One of the first things that might surprised you is the “sh” sound for the “y” and “ll” – like saying “sho” instead of “yo” (I). It’s a hallmark of Rioplatense Spanish, and while it felt a bit tricky at first, it soon feels natural. Dancing into Culture: Tango, Mate, and More!

TangoSpanish isn’t just about grammar lessons; it’s a portal to Argentine culture. We learn vocabulary related to experiences, not just abstract concepts.

Tango Insights: You will explor the history of tango, its origins in the working-class barrios of Buenos Aires, and why it’s called “a sad thought that is danced.” Learning phrases for the milonga (tango dance hall) or even just understanding the emotion of a classic tango song is incredibly enriching

🫂 “El abrazo” (el ah-BRAH-so) – “The embrace.” In tango, it’s the fundamental connection between dancers.

💃 “Milonga” (mee-LON-ga) – The place where people go to dance tango socially.

 

The Ritual of Mate: You teacher will teach you about mate (MAH-teh), the traditional herbal infusion, and how sharing it is a symbol of friendship and hospitality. It’s a social ritual – you share the same mate gourd and bombilla (straw)!

    • ¿Querés unos mates? (keh-RES OO-nos MAH-tes) – “Do you want some mate?” A common invitation to share this special drink.

 The Power of Asado: And, of course, the asado (ah-SAH-do), the Argentine barbecue! It’s not just food; it’s a gathering, a celebration, and a central pillar of Argentine social life.

    • ¡Qué rico! (keh REE-ko) – “How delicious!” Perfect to say at an asado.

  1. Did you know Argentina has more psychologists per capita than any other country in the world? It’s a culture that truly values talking through things!
  2. Buenos Aires boasts one of the world’s widest avenues, Avenida 9 de Julio, with the iconic Obelisco right in the middle. It’s re grande (really big)!
  3. And, of course, the passion for futball (soccer)! From the legendary Messi and Maradona debate to the intense rivalry of Boca vs. River, it’s deeply embedded in the national identity. Learning a cheer like “¡Vamos Argentina!” (VAH-mos ar-hen-TEE-nah! – Go Argentina!) is a must!
  4. Argentina is home to both the highest peak in the Americas (Mount Aconcagua) and one of the world’s lowest points (Laguna del Carbón). Talk about extremes!
